压力容器用大幅面爆炸焊接不锈钢复合板缺陷形成机理

Mechanism Analysis of Defects Caused by Explosive Welding in Large Acreage Stainless Steel Clad Plate for Pressure Vessel

Abstract

It is appeared some strip defects ,which 80~200 mm width and 400~600 mm,maximum 2000 mm length,located near the diagonal line ,1000 ~2000 mm left corner, in the interface of metal clad plates when the large acreage metal clad , especially stainless steel clad plates which the width of more than 2600 mm and 10000 mm long was explosive welded .Such defects was effected the overall quality of the clad plate and increased the product manufacturing costs as well as limited the larger acreage metal clad plate products of explosive welding .Based on the analysis of interfacial space exhaust path ,this arti-cle is reasonable explanation the defects appeared in explosive welding of large acreage stainless steel clad plates,so as to take effective methods to reduce and eliminate such defects .
